Which number is equivalent to the expression 8+2(12-5) A 22 B 27 C 70 D 115

We will be using PEMDAS rule here :

P - Parentheses first

E - Exponents (ie Powers and Square Roots, etc.)

MD - Multiplication and Division (left-to-right)

AS - Addition and Subtraction (left-to-right)

8+2(12-5)

Step 1:

Solving parenthesis first:

8+2(7)

Step 2:

Multiplying 2*7

8+14

Step 3:

Adding 8 and 14

22

Answer is 22

Find the common difference of the following sequence.​
Darya [45]

You have the correct answer. It is choice B) -1/4

=======================================================

Explanation:

This is because we're adding -1/4 to each term to get the next one. In other words, we're subtracting 1/4 from each term to get the next one.

  • term2 = term1+(d) = 1/2 + (-1/4) = 1/2 - 1/4 = 2/4 - 1/4 = 1/4
  • term3 = term2+(d) = 1/4 + (-1/4) = 1/4 - 1/4 = 0
  • term4 = term3+(d) = 0 + (-1/4) = 0 - 1/4 = -1/4
  • term5 = term4+(d) = -1/4 + (-1/4) = -2/4 = -1/2

and so on.

----------

To find the common difference, all we have to do is subtract any term from its previous one.

For example:

d = (term2) - (term1)

d = (1/4) - (1/2)

d = (1/4) - (2/4)

d = (1-2)/4

d = -1/4

The order of subtraction matters, so we cannot say d = term1-term2.
